Gilbert Cocteau, Auguste Beau - Fleur Brisee et Poete Maudit** _ ... light and shadow... my desire to achieve that disquieting feeling so characteristic of the story...story that I am madly in love with... Chopin... _ Preludes Op 28 No 4 _ ... I had no choice, this wall just had to be like this! - choked and shady with some scanty light.
Quality of scan was really poor so I decided to draw the whole illustration once again. That also gave me much better opportunity in making subtle changes. You can see the result of my work here:
You will spot all differences after you compare it with the oryginal art - here in its oryginal dimensions:
All my work has been done using Wacome Graphire4 tablet +Corel Painter Essentials 3 and (finally) Photoshop CS3.
